La finance décentralisée (DeFi) vient de connaître un séisme. Une attaque sur Curve Finance, faisant partie des cibles, a déclenché une onde de choc à travers l’écosystème, soulevant des interrogations cruciales. Alors que la poussière commence à retomber, une question obsédante se profile à l’horizon : quel avenir attend désormais la DeFi ?
La finance décentralisée face au chaos
L’écosystème de la finance décentralisée (DeFi) traverse une période de turbulence sans précédent suite à une cascade d’attaques ayant frappé des plateformes majeures, Curve Finance y compris. Les pertes, évaluées autour de 70 millions de dollars, ne sont pas seulement monétaires.
Had Aave v2 or other DeFi lending protocols used the (now drained) $CRV/ETH Curve pool as an on-chain oracle, they would have gotten completely rekt with bad debt
Quite scary to think about
This is why Chainlink feeds provide market-wide coverage (weighting CEXs + DEXs) pic.twitter.com/7BtmpOPT2T
— ChainLinkGod.eth (@ChainLinkGod) July 31, 2023
Elles ont également sapé la confiance en l’infrastructure entière de la DeFi. Cette onde de choc a conduit à un retrait massif de fonds par les investisseurs inquiets, exacerbant la tension en augmentant les frais d’emprunt.
Ainsi, un nuage d’incertitude plane à présent sur l’avenir de la DeFi, mettant en évidence la nécessité d’examiner plus en profondeur les mécanismes de sécurité et la résilience du système face à de telles vulnérabilités.
Lueur d’espoir au milieu du désastre
Face à la série d’attaques ayant ébranlé le monde de la finance décentralisée, certains acteurs de l’industrie se sont distingués par leur capacité à atténuer les dommages. Parmi ces événements chaotiques, un acte inattendu de prévention s’est manifesté lorsque les hackers ont eux-mêmes retiré des actifs de certains pools de prêt sur Curve, évitant ainsi leur vol total.
Parallèlement, l’intervention opportune d’experts en valeur extractible maximale (MEV) a joué un rôle crucial dans la limitation des dégâts. En faisant usage de leur compréhension sophistiquée des blockchains, ces experts ont agi en amont, stoppant plusieurs des attaques.
Ces actions conjointes, bien qu’elles n’aient pas pu éviter entièrement les pertes, ont néanmoins démontré un degré de résilience et de riposte dans un écosystème qui se trouve constamment sous la menace. Le défi demeure de tirer des enseignements de ces incidents pour renforcer la sécurité future.
La vulnérabilité de la DeFi
Les récentes attaques ayant frappé la finance décentralisée (DeFi) ont mis en évidence une faiblesse inattendue, notamment liée à l’emploi du langage de programmation Vyper pour l’élaboration de contrats intelligents sur Ethereum.
La découverte d’une vulnérabilité dans des versions antérieures de ce langage, propices aux attaques dites de “réentrance”, a soulevé des questions pressantes sur la robustesse des mécanismes actuels.
Cette situation délicate souligne non seulement l’importance de la rigueur dans la sélection des outils et des langages de programmation, mais aussi le besoin impératif d’un contrôle plus strict dans le développement de contrats intelligents.
L’avenir de la DeFi reste incertain dans le sillage de ces attaques. Un débat animé a lieu concernant l’évolution possible des échanges décentralisés (DEX). Certains envisagent l’adoption de modèles de “meilleure exécution” qui prennent certains aspects du trading de crypto-monnaies hors chaîne, dans le but de réduire les coûts et d’accroître l’efficacité.
Cependant, la récente série d’attaques soulève des questions sur les risques associés à la perte de transparence et d’immuabilité que la blockchain offre. Alors que le monde de la DeFi se remet de ces attaques, il est clair que la route vers l’avenir sera semée de défis et d’incertitudes.
Source : Coindesk
Sur le même sujet :
- Le fondateur de Curve Finance a réussi à vendre 72 millions de CRV à 15 entités différentes
- Les investisseurs ont-ils toujours confiance en la DeFi après le piratage de Curve Finance ?
- La BNB Smart Chain a subi des attaques similaires à celle de Curve Finance